Srtyuiu. Just a random string of letters. What does it mean? Where did it come from? These are the questions that have plagued analysts for decades. Some say it's a code, others claim it's a message from aliens. But https://luchjdu466078.blogdigy.com/unraveling-the-mystery-of-srtyuiu-50704223